I am looking to speak with a Graduate Geotechnical Engineer in Durham with experience in site investigation to join a dynamic well respected Geotechnical Contractor, joining a rapidly expanding team. You will have the opportunity to work on a mixture of schemes including residential, commercial, rail, public sector infrastructure projects and coal mining assessments.
As a Graduate Geotechnical Engineer your responsibilities include, phase 1 preliminary desk studies, designing and undertaking site investigations for brownfield and contaminated land projects, providing solutions for foundation design, earthworks design, soil mechanics and slope stability analysis.
Graduate Geotechnical Engineer will get involved in projects management, tenders and bids, designing GI's, remedial methods, risk assessments, validations, and onsite remedial monitoring.
To progress as a Graduate Geotechnical Engineer, you must:
Obtain a 2:1 In Geology or Geotechnics. Ideally with an MSc in Engineering Geology.
Between 6 months and 2 years experience within a Geo-Environmental/Geotechnical Consultancy or Contractor
Experience managing Ground investigations using various drilling techniques
Experience report writing, ideally interpretive.
